Analysis

Brazil recorded 0 1000 USD for france — industrial roundwood, coniferous (export/import) — export in 2016. That is the lowest value across all 8 years on record.

That represents a change of down 100.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, france — industrial roundwood, coniferous (export/import) — export in Brazil peaked at 1,184 1000 USD in 2000 and was at its lowest, 0 1000 USD, in 2011.

Brazil ranks 36th of 36 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
